just across from campo de santana, centro is home to a particularly famous sub neighborhood called saara - a shopping district with over a thousand stores, tons of restaurants, and definitely some of the best bargains in town - saara is one of the most buzzing and eclectic areas of the centre, and is beloved amongst locals and residents for its incomparable deals and great breadth of products. One of the main streets of what is now saara was in 1716 known as Rua dos Governadors, or Governor's Street, because it was where the governors resided.
